## Step 4: Tune export memory limits

When migrating Ledgerbird to version 9, the spreadsheet export worker now streams rows instead of buffering the entire workbook in memory. Support agents should know that exports above 200,000 rows previously caused out-of-memory restarts; the new streaming mode caps heap usage but requires explicit limits to be set before the first export runs. Apply the following values to the export worker before restarting it.

settings of yahag-yafog:
[pramir]
host = pramir.qirvancorp.internal
user = pramir_svc
database = pramir_prod

## Runbook Fragment: Account Recovery — Address Autocomplete Widget

Welcome aboard. This procedure restores the service account powering the Larkspur autocomplete widget used across Dunmore Retail checkout pages. First, verify the widget's suggestion feed is failing in the Hollis staging console. Next, disable the stale token in the Perrin admin panel and request a re-issue. The re-issue flow requires unsealing the credentials vault, which accepts the recovery passphrase recorded immediately below this paragraph.

vault phrase of bagaf-kajeg = jorath-feniel-briir-siliel-ralix

Please note that the turnstiles at the Wrenfield Annex main lobby are being upgraded between 22:00 and 05:00 this week. Night-shift staff escorting visitors must use the secondary gate beside the security desk, signing each guest in and out individually. Until the new readers are commissioned, the secondary gate operates on the keypad code below.

badge for hahip-bagag: bdg-FIJ-9

Subject: Quickstore 4.2 — bloom filter now fronts the KV layer

Plugin authors: starting with this release, Quickstore places a bloom filter ahead of the key-value store. Negative lookups return faster; false positives fall through safely. No API changes are required on your side. Verify your plugin against the staging build referenced below.

session token of fahif-tadup = htk3_9c7